Ultra-Endurance Cyclist Seriously Injured After Being Struck by Vehicle During Tour Divide

Grant County, NM (July 9, 2026) — Ultra-endurance cyclist Alyssa Secreto sustained life-threatening injuries after a vehicle reportedly struck her while she was competing in the 2026 Tour Divide.

The collision happened around 4:30 a.m. on July 2, when Secreto was approximately 60 miles from the race finish in New Mexico. Emergency responders airlifted the 35-year-old to a hospital in El Paso, Texas, where she underwent emergency surgery.

According to updates from those close to her, Secreto remains in stable condition but suffered extensive injuries, including multiple fractured vertebrae, cracked ribs, a broken arm, internal injuries, a brain bleed, and damage to several organs. She is expected to undergo additional medical procedures as part of her recovery.

Authorities believe the vehicle that struck Secreto was traveling between 50 and 60 mph. The circumstances surrounding the crash remain under investigation.

Secreto is a well-known endurance athlete who was competing in her second Tour Divide after completing the event in 2024. She had also recently won the 2026 Grand Loop endurance race.
